
About
This Chinese restaurant is led by owner‑chef Shigeji Niiyama, who refined his craft in modern Chinese cuisine under the guidance of culinary master Yuji Wakiya. As an evolutionary sister restaurant to Reika in Shinjuku Gyoen, Aoyama, and Hibiya, it offers nouvelle Chinese cuisine that elevates tradition through a distinctive and contemporary sensibility.
The signature “Buddha Jumps Over the Wall” is a standout dish, prepared by steaming 17 varieties of premium dried ingredients—including dried abalone, shark fin, and dried shellfish—for half a day to draw out profound layers of umami. The course menu also incorporates seasonal luxury ingredients such as rare basking shark, sea urchin, Hanasaki crab, and abalone. To preserve the natural character of each ingredient, no flavor enhancers are used, allowing every dish to express a fresh and modern interpretation of Chinese cuisine.
The restaurant also features an impressive selection of approximately 200 wines, primarily from France. Through pairings curated by the sommelier—combining Champagne, wine, and Shaoxing wine—guests can enjoy pairings that highlight and deepen the nuances of each dish.
The interior is a serene white‑beige space inspired by a bamboo forest. Centered around natural white oak, the refined 18‑seat dining room harmonizes modern and classical elements, accented by paintings from Seisho Taketomi, a Southern Song‑style artist who studied traditional techniques in Shanghai. Guests are invited to relax and savor their meal in this elegant and thoughtfully designed atmosphere.
